/**
* virGetVersion:
* @libVer: return value for the library version (OUT)
- * @type: the type of connection/driver looked at, if @typeVer is not NULL
- * @typeVer: optional return value for the version of the hypervisor (OUT)
- *
- * Provides information on up to two versions: @libVer is the version of the
- * library and will always be set unless an error occurs, in which case an
- * error code will be returned. If @typeVer is not NULL it will be set to the
- * version of the hypervisor @type against which the library was compiled.
- * If @type is NULL, "Xen" is assumed, if @type is unknown or not
- * available, an error code will be returned and @typeVer will be 0.
+ * @type: ignored; pass NULL
+ * @typeVer: pass NULL; for historical purposes duplicates @libVer if
+ * non-NULL
+ *
+ * Provides version information. @libVer is the version of the
+ * library and will always be set unless an error occurs, in which case
+ * an error code will be returned. @typeVer exists for historical
+ * compatibility; if it is not NULL it will duplicate @libVer (it was
+ * originally intended to return hypervisor information based on @type,
+ * but due to the design of remote clients this is not reliable). To
+ * get the version of the running hypervisor use the virConnectGetVersion
+ * function instead. To get the libvirt library version used by a
+ * connection use the virConnectGetLibVersion instead.
*
* Returns -1 in case of failure, 0 otherwise, and values for @libVer and
* @typeVer have the format major * 1,000,000 + minor * 1,000 + release.
*/
